This month, we’re exploring three powerful fruits of the Spirit – patience, kindness, and goodness. Today, we’re starting with patience, something we all need but often find challenging, especially on those days when everything seems to test us. Kim Reisman shared a story in this week’s devotional that you might find familiar: a teacher faced with a chaotic day, restless children, and one little boy whose boots just wouldn’t fit! As we laugh and sympathize with her struggle, we also get a glimpse of what it means to have patience in our everyday lives. But beyond just surviving tough days, what if we could learn to cultivate the kind of patience God shows us? In the Scriptures, we see a beautiful image of God as the Shepherd who never gives up, always patient and steadfast in love. As you read, I hope you’ll find encouragement and maybe even a fresh perspective on those moments when patience seems in short supply. Take a moment to reflect, and maybe consider what it is that tests your patience the most. Why do these situations get to us? And how can we draw closer to that perfect patience God has with each of us?
